The window has a long and fascinating history. It has evolved in response to the availability of resources, developments in design and technology, and the demands of those who use them. At once functional and aesthetic, the window must keep out the weather, provide ventilation, prevent intruders and buffer sound. Windows are also integral to the appearance of buildings, reflecting the practice and taste of particular regions or periods. The window cannot be seen in isolation from the building fabric in which it is set. This book presents, for the first time, a comprehensive treatment of the history and conservation of windows. Bringing together the practical experience of conservation practitioners with the knowledge of leading historians in the field, it offers a unique understanding of the window structure. Part 1 covers the history of the window including the development in glass technology. It also provides an illustrated glossary of window types. Part 2 reviews the changes in policy and legislation and discusses structural issues, decay mechanisms and the current stringent performance standards and how they affect historic windows. Part 3 focuses on the materials used in the construction of windows and the craft of leaded glazing. It details the appropriate techniques for repair and conservation.

Die Studie rekonstruiert die Geschichte, wie sich gelehrte Autoren des Späthumanismus mit ihren in Texten artikulierten Ideen an einem Problem abarbeiten: dem Problem, wie man die beschleunigt anwachsende Menge der Bücher und des Wissens ordnen und kanalisieren kann. In vierfacher Hinsicht schließt die Arbeit eine Forschungslücke: Erstens rekonstruiert sie den Zeitraum von 1580 bis 1630 als zentrale Periode der Geschichte imaginierter Bibliotheken. Zweitens zeigt sie so, inwiefern die Konzeption imaginierter Bibliotheken eine zentrale Rolle für die Konstruktion von Ordnungen des Wissens in der Frühen Neuzeit spielt. Drittens argumentiert die Studie dafür, dass die Geschichte von Bibliotheken in Literatur als Geschichte von Ideen gelesen werden muss, mit denen Autoren auf Probleme reagieren. Viertens macht sie deutlich, dass der Vorstellungsraum imaginierter Bibliotheken in der untersuchten Periode im Hinblick auf eine Reihe zentraler Aspekte textsortenübergreifend große Homogenität aufweist, dass es aber textsortenintern starke Traditionslinien gibt, die sich untereinander beträchtlich unterscheiden.

Architectural work on existing structures has become enormously important in recent years. For the majority of architects, this is where future market opportunities will lie. This book provides a comprehensive introduction to the field and is thus addressed to all practitioners, students, and building sponsors whose interest goes beyond an initial encounter with this wideranging field of activity. Contradicting the conventional view that creative design work is the exclusive province of new building design, the authors offer a nuanced account of active and creative strategies for planning, design, and execution. Subjects considered range from town planning issues through the overall project cycle and its individual phases all the way to building management. Special focuses are the grammar of design as well as the issues arising through collaboration of different experts. In order to illuminate this broad and complex spectrum of topics, the book incorporates thirty examples of projects from Europe and North America, in which buildings from a huge variety of periods - from the Middle Ages to the 1960s - are transferred into the present.
